The court denies the defendant's request to modify a protective order to disclose documents to judicial officers in civil cases, finding that the defendant failed to establish good cause. The defendant provided vague and speculative assertions about the need for disclosure, and the facts she sought to convey were already publicly available. The court ruled that the request was unnecessary and denied it.
